Building a Corporate Website
A corporate website serves as the digital headquarters of a corporation, providing a centralized platform for showcasing products and services, sharing company information, and engaging with stakeholders. It is often the first point of contact for potential customers, investors, and job seekers, making it essential for corporations to invest in a well-designed and user-friendly website. Strategies for building a corporate website include:
- User-Friendly Design: Designing a website with intuitive navigation, clear layout, and mobile responsiveness to ensure a seamless user experience across devices.
- Compelling Content: Creating high-quality, informative content that showcases the corporation's value proposition, expertise, and offerings while engaging visitors and encouraging them to explore further.
- Visual Appeal: Incorporating visually appealing elements such as images, videos, and infographics to enhance the website's aesthetics and captivate visitors' attention.
- Optimization for Search Engines: Implementing search engine optimization (SEO) best practices to improve the website's visibility in search engine results and attract organic traffic.
- Accessibility: Ensuring that the website complies with accessibility standards and is accessible to users with disabilities, including features such as alt text for images and keyboard navigation.
- Security: Implementing robust security measures, such as SSL encryption and regular security updates, to protect the website from cyber threats and safeguard sensitive data.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) and Online Visibility
Search engine optimization (SEO) is essential for improving online visibility and driving organic traffic to corporate websites, ensuring that they rank high in search engine results for relevant keywords and queries. Strategies for SEO and online visibility include:
- Keyword Research: Conducting keyword research to identify relevant search terms and phrases that potential customers are using to find products and services related to the corporation's offerings.
- On-Page Optimization: Optimizing website content, meta-tags, headers, and URLs with target keywords to improve search engine crawlers' understanding of the website's relevance and authority.
- Off-Page Optimization: Building high-quality backlinks from authoritative websites, directories, and social media platforms to increase the website's credibility and authority in the eyes of search engines.
- Mobile Optimization: Ensuring that the website is mobile-friendly and optimized for mobile devices, as mobile search traffic continues to grow and Google prioritizes mobile-friendly websites in search results.
- Local SEO: Optimizing the website for local search by claiming and optimizing Google My Business listings, optimizing local keywords, and generating positive reviews and citations from local directories.
- Regular Monitoring and Optimization: Continuously monitoring website performance, tracking keyword rankings, and making adjustments to SEO strategies based on performance data and algorithm updates.

Data Analytics and Performance Measurement
Data analytics play a vital role in tracking and analyzing the effectiveness of corporate online presence and digital marketing efforts, providing valuable insights into audience behavior, engagement patterns, and campaign performance. Strategies for data analytics and performance measurement include:
- Setting Key Performance Indicators (KPIs): Establishing measurable goals and KPIs, such as website traffic, conversion rates, engagement metrics, and return on investment (ROI), to evaluate the success of digital marketing campaigns and initiatives.
- Implementing Analytics Tools: Utilizing web analytics tools, such as Google Analytics, Adobe Analytics, or Piwik, to track and analyze website traffic, user behavior, and conversion funnels.
- Attribution Modeling: Implementing attribution modeling techniques, such as first-click, last-click, or multi-touch attribution, to understand the contribution of different marketing channels and touchpoints to conversions and revenue.
- A/B Testing: Conducting A/B tests and experiments to optimize website design, content, and calls-to-action (CTAs) based on data-driven insights and performance metrics.
- Iterative Optimization: Continuously analyzing performance data, identifying areas for improvement, and making data-driven decisions to refine digital marketing strategies and tactics for better results.
Reporting and Visualization: Creating custom reports and dashboards to visualize key metrics and performance indicators, providing stakeholders with actionable insights and actionable recommendations for improving online presence and achieving business objectives.
- Data Privacy and Compliance: Ensuring compliance with data privacy regulations,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A), by implementing data protection measures, obtaining consent from users, and securing sensitive data against unauthorized access or disclosure.
Cybersecurity and Data Privacy
Cybersecurity and data privacy are critical considerations for corporations to protect their assets, safeguard customer information, and maintain trust and credibility with stakeholders. Strategies for cybersecurity and data privacy include:
- Implementing Security Measures: Deploying robust cybersecurity measures, such as firewalls, encryption, multi-factor authentication, and intrusion detection systems, to protect against cyber threats and unauthorized access.
- Employee Training: Providing ongoing cybersecurity awareness training and education to employees to raise awareness of security risks, promote best practices, and mitigate the risk of human error or negligence.
- Incident Response Planning: Developing an incident response plan and protocol to effectively respond to cybersecurity incidents, such as data breaches, malware attacks, or ransomware infections, and minimize the impact on business operations and reputation.
- Compliance with Regulations: Ensuring compliance with data privacy regulations and industry standards, such as the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A), the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ard (PCI DSS), and the European Union's General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R), to avoid regulatory penalties and legal liabilities.
- Vendor Management: Implementing vendor risk management processes to assess the cybersecurity posture of third-party vendors and service providers, such as cloud providers, software vendors, and outsourcing partners, and ensure they adhere to security standards and practices.

Globalization and Multilingual Online Presence
Globalization presents both challenges and opportunities for corporations seeking to expand their online presence to international markets and reach diverse linguistic and cultural audiences. Strategies for globalization and multilingual online presence include:
- Localization of Content: Adapting website content, product descriptions, marketing materials, and customer communications to the language, culture, and preferences of target international markets to resonate with local audiences and drive engagement and conversion.
- Translation Services: Utilizing professional translation services or localization platforms to accurately translate and localize content into multiple languages while ensuring cultural relevance, accuracy, and sensitivity to linguistic nuances.
- Multilingual SEO: Conducting multilingual keyword research and implementing multilingual SEO strategies to optimize website content and metadata for search engines in different languages and regions, increasing visibility and attracting organic traffic from international audiences.
- Country-Specific Domains: Registering country-code top-level domains (ccTLDs) or subdomains for international markets to establish local credibility, improve search engine rankings, and provide a tailored online experience for users in specific regions.
- Cultural Sensitivity: Understanding and respecting cultural differences, customs, and preferences when creating and disseminating content to international audiences to avoid cultural misunderstandings, misinterpretations, or offensive messaging.
- Localized Customer Support: Offering multilingual customer support options, such as live chat, email support, or phone support, in languages spoken by target international audiences to provide assistance, address inquiries, and resolve issues promptly and effectively.
Integrating customer relationship management (CRM) systems with corporate online presence enables corporations to centralize customer data, track interactions across various touchpoints, and deliver personalized marketing messages and experiences to enhance customer engagement and satisfaction. Strategies for CRM integration include:
- Centralized Customer Data: Integrating CRM systems with corporate websites, e-commerce platforms, and marketing automation tools to consolidate customer data, including contact information, purchase history, preferences, and interactions, into a centralized database for easy access and analysis.
- Segmentation and Targeting: Leveraging CRM data to segment customers based on demographic, behavioral, and transactional attributes and create targeted marketing campaigns and personalized communication strategies tailored to the unique needs and preferences of different customer segments.
- Lead Nurturing and Conversion: Implementing lead nurturing workflows and automated email marketing campaigns to engage leads at various stages of the sales funnel, deliver relevant content and offers, and guide them through the buying journey to increase conversion rates and drive revenue.
- Customer Retention and Loyalty: Developing customer retention programs, loyalty initiatives, and referral programs to reward and incentivize repeat purchases, referrals, and brand advocacy, and foster long-term relationships with customers to maximize lifetime value and reduce churn.
- Performance Tracking and Reporting: Utilizing CRM analytics and reporting tools to track key performance metrics, such as customer acquisition costs (CAC), customer lifetime value (CLV), conversion rates, and customer satisfaction scores, and measure the impact of CRM integration on business outcomes and ROI.
